Transaction 341417f2c5355a2a101d10c5ba2b8117fc362e0ad03d5c2ae134d4f61bef1b96
1 Input
1 Output
-
341417f2c5355a2a101d10c5ba2b8117fc362e0ad03d5c2ae134d4f61bef1b96:0
- value
- 8590520
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ebdfe15812e7311a9e1e043b82988f84496b057e
- address
- bc1qa007zkqjuuc348s7qsac9xy0s3ykkpt79e7c6x